R offers many methods to deal with missing data WebAug 3, 2024 · Use is.na () and mean () to replace NA: df$Ozone[is.na(df$Ozone)] <- mean(df$Ozone, na.rm = TRUE) First, this code finds all the occurrences of NA in the Ozone column. Next, it calculates the mean of all the values in the Ozone column - excluding the NA values with the na.rm argument. Usage allNA(x, margin) Arguments WebMar 6, 2024 · To select rows of an R data frame that are non-Na, we can use complete.cases function with single square brackets. For example, if we have a data frame called that contains some missing values (NA) then the selection of rows that are non-NA can be done by using the command df [complete.cases (df),]. bitwarden new features

WebThe default method in the R programming language is listwise deletion, which deletes all rows with missing values in one or more columns. Basic data manipulations can be done with the na.omit command or with the is.na R function.

WebOct 16, 2016 · The select_if part choses any column where is.na is true ( TRUE ). Then we take those columns and for each of them, we sum up ( summarise_each) the number of NAs. Note that each column is summarized to a single value, that’s why we use summarise.

If empty, all columns are used. Details Another way to interpret drop_na () is that it only keeps the "complete" rows (where no rows contain missing values). Internally, this completeness is computed through vctrs::vec_detect_complete ().
